Transaction 9253a91129bc94e1beacce590c25d841920e602e04c939aba6a60893306fe0f4
1 Input
1 Output
-
9253a91129bc94e1beacce590c25d841920e602e04c939aba6a60893306fe0f4:0
- value
- 732162
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 68bcf08828acd039ac1fde58faeed87dfd0ca73a OP_EQUAL
- address
- 3BEpYFEBjHw4R4n73M88QfLgJwEacEgmHG